Movement And Mechanics

At the heart of the Rolex Milgauss Z-Blue 116400GV beats the Rolex 3131 caliber offering a 48-hour power reserve running at 28,800 vph with 31 jewels. The Rolex Oyster Perpetual 41 Yellow 124300 is powered by the Rolex 3230 with a 70-hour power reserve operating at 28,800 vph featuring 31 jewels. The Rolex Oyster Perpetual 41 Yellow 124300 wins on power reserve with a 22-hour advantage, which means less frequent winding for those who rotate watches.

Dimensions And Wearability

The Rolex Milgauss Z-Blue 116400GV features a 40.0mm case at 13.0mm thick with a 48.0mm lug-to-lug measurement, crafted in Oystersteel. The Rolex Oyster Perpetual 41 Yellow 124300 comes in at 41.0mm and 11.5mm thick with 48.0mm lug-to-lug, constructed from Oystersteel. The Rolex Milgauss Z-Blue 116400GV wears more compactly on the wrist, making it potentially more suitable for smaller wrists or those who prefer understated proportions. At 136g, the Rolex Oyster Perpetual 41 Yellow 124300 is the lighter of the two.

Pricing And Value

At retail, the Rolex Milgauss Z-Blue 116400GV lists for $9,100 compared to $6,150 for the Rolex Oyster Perpetual 41 Yellow 124300. The Rolex Oyster Perpetual 41 Yellow 124300 is the more accessible option at MSRP, saving $2,950 at retail. On the secondary market, the Rolex Milgauss Z-Blue 116400GV trades around $15,000 while the Rolex Oyster Perpetual 41 Yellow 124300 commands approximately $9,000. The Rolex Milgauss Z-Blue 116400GV trades at a 65% premium over retail, indicating strong demand and investment potential. The Rolex Oyster Perpetual 41 Yellow 124300 carries a 46% market premium.
